"""Testing the neighborhood module."""
import pytest
import toponetx as tnx
import topoembedx as tex
class TestNeighborhood:
"""Test the neighborhood module of TopoEmbedX."""
def test_neighborhood_from_complex_raise_error(self):
"""Testing if right assertion is raised for incorrect type."""
with pytest.raises(TypeError) as e:
tex.neighborhood.neighborhood_from_complex(1)
assert (
str(e.value)
== """Input Complex can only be a Simplicial, Cell or Combinatorial Complex."""
)
def test_neighborhood_from_complex_matrix_dimension_cell_complex(self):
"""Testing the matrix dimensions for the adjacency and coadjacency matrices."""
# Testing for the case of Cell Complex
cc1 = tnx.classes.CellComplex(
[[0, 1, 2, 3], [1, 2, 3, 4], [1, 3, 4, 5, 6, 7, 8]]
)
cc2 = tnx.classes.CellComplex([[0, 1, 2], [1, 2, 3]])
ind, A = tex.neighborhood.neighborhood_from_complex(cc1)
assert A.todense().shape == tuple([9, 9])
assert len(ind) == 9
ind, A = tex.neighborhood.neighborhood_from_complex(cc2)
assert A.todense().shape == tuple([4, 4])
assert len(ind) == 4
ind, A = tex.neighborhood.neighborhood_from_complex(
cc1, neighborhood_type="!adj"
)
assert A.todense().shape == tuple([9, 9])
assert len(ind) == 9
ind, A = tex.neighborhood.neighborhood_from_complex(
cc2, neighborhood_type="!adj"
)
assert A.todense().shape == tuple([4, 4])
assert len(ind) == 4
